Fiera Capital Corporation and the Canadian District of the United Brotherhood of Carpenters and Joiners of America (UBC) have launched a new platform to initially invest over C$800m (€489m) in union-built real asset projects across Canada.
The Canadian Built Opportunities Platform initially split its investments equally between infrastructure and real estate, with a plan to reach over C$1bn in assets within three years.
The platform will prioritise greenfield projects in multi-residential housing and essential public infrastructure, with all developments using union labour to ensure high standards for wages, workplace safety and benefits for members of the Canadian District of the UBC.
Infrastructure investments will be managed by Fiera Infrastructure under the leadership of managing director Jamie Crotin. The mandate will focus on social and civil infrastructure, transportation and renewable energy projects.
Real estate investments will be managed by Fiera Real Estate Investments, led by Pierre Pelletier, senior MD and head of development and debt, with a strategic focus on urban and multi-residential developments and industrial projects.
